Unconventional ferromagnetic and spin-glass states of the reentrant spin glass Fe0.7Al0.3

arXiv:cond-mat/9810265 · doi:10.1103/PhysRevLett.82.4711

Abstract

Spin excitations of single crystal Fe0.7Al0.3 were investigated over a wide range in energy and reciprocal space with inelastic neutron scattering. In the ferromagnetic phase, propagating spin wave modes become paramagnon-like diffusive modes beyond a critical wave vector q0, indicating substantial disorder in the long-range ordered state. In the spin glass phase, spin dynamics is strongly q-dependent, suggesting remnant short-range spin correlations. Quantitative model for S(energy,q) in the ``ferromagnetic'' phase is determined.
